/* Driver for routine quad3d */
#include <stdio.h>
#include <math.h>
#define NRANSI
#include "nr.h"
#define PI 3.1415927
#define NVAL 10
static float xmax;
float func(float x,float y,float z)
{
return x*x+y*y+z*z;
}
float z1(float x,float y)
{
return (float) -sqrt(xmax*xmax-x*x-y*y);
}
float z2(float x,float y)
{
return (float) sqrt(xmax*xmax-x*x-y*y);
}
float yy1(float x)
{
return (float) -sqrt(xmax*xmax-x*x);
}
float yy2(float x)
{
return (float) sqrt(xmax*xmax-x*x);
}
int main(void)
{
int i;
float xmin,s;
printf("Integral of r^2 over a spherical volume\n\n");
printf("%13s %10s %11s\n","radius","QUAD3D","Actual");
for (i=1;i<=NVAL;i++) {
xmax=0.1*i;
xmin = -xmax;
s=quad3d(func,xmin,xmax);
printf("%12.2f %12.6f %11.6f\n",
xmax,s,4.0*PI*pow(xmax,5.0)/5.0);
}
return 0;
}
#undef NRANSI
